Problem 1.169

Particle 1 experiences a perfectly elastic collision with a stationary particle 2 . Determine their mass ratio, if (a) after a head-on collision the particles fly apart in the opposite directions with equal velocities; (b) the particles fly apart symmetrically relative to the initial motion direction of particle 1 with the angle of divergence \(\theta=60^{\circ}\)

Reveal Answer
 (a) m1/m2=1/3; (b) m1/m2=1+2cosθ=2.0 . \text { (a) } m_{1} / m_{2}=1 / 3 ; \text { (b) } m_{1} / m_{2}=1+2 \cos \theta=2.0 \text { . }
